Magicians Deserve Respect

Magicians of the tricks kind (not fictional characters like Harry) are not always given the respect they deserve. They are made fun of by the media and in Hollywood films. It’s really too bad because it takes an extraordinary amount of energy, initiative and talent to put together a magic act.

Many Creative Hats

Magicians have to wear many creative hats. They are the “director” looking a themselves in the mirror while practicing, much like dancers do, making sure that every move is right. But unlike most dancers, they don’t benefit from a choreographer and have the taxing job of being both the performer and the eyes of the audience during rehearsal.

Magicians are Actors

Magicians are also actors. The famous French Magician who Houdini got his name from, Robert Houdin (Houdini added an “i”) was known to have said something along the lines of “A magician is an actor playing the role of a magician.”

Magician’s Are Writers

Magicians are also writers. Most of the time they write their own “patter” (what a magician calls the dialogue that is spoken).

  1. Astral Projection Astral projection is a term used in esotericism to describe a willful out-of-body experience that assumes the existence of a soul or consciousness called an “astral body” that is separate from the physical body and capable of travelling outside it throughout the universe.
  2. Clairvoyance Clairvoyance is the alleged ability to gain information about an object, person, location, or physical event through extrasensory perception. Any person who is claimed to have such ability is said accordingly to be a clairvoyant.
  3. Cold Reading Cold reading is a set of techniques used by mentalists, psychics, fortune-tellers, mediums, illusionists, and scam artists to imply that the reader knows much more about the person than the reader actually does.
  4. Divination Divination is the attempt to gain insight into a question or situation by way of an occultist, standardized process or ritual.
  5. Energy Healing Energy Healing is also known as energy medicine, energy therapy, vibration medicine, psychic healing, spiritual medicine or spiritual healing which are all branches of alternative medicine based on a pseudo-scientific belief that healers can channel healing energy into a patient and effect positive results.
  6. ESP ESP or Extra Sensory Perception, also called sixth sense, includes claimed reception of information not gained through the recognized physical senses, but sensed with the mind.
  7. Hypnotism Hypnostism is a human condition involving focused attention, reduced peripheral awareness, and an enhanced capacity to respond to suggestion. The term may also refer to an art, skill, or act of inducing hypnosis.
  8. Mediumship Mediumship is the practice of purportedly mediating communication between spirits of the dead and living human beings. Practitioners are known as “mediums.” There are different types of mediumship, including spirit channeling.
  9. Mind Control Mind Control is a kind of brainwashing in tandem with the concept that the human mind can be altered or controlled by certain psychological or cosmic techniques.
  10. Mind Reading Mind reading in parapsychology is the transfer of information between individuals by means other than the five senses. The illusion of telepathy in the performing art of mentalism. Thought identification, the use of neuroimaging techniques to read human minds.
  11. Precognition Precognition, also called prescience, future vision, future sight is a claimed psychic ability to see events in the future. As with other forms of extrasensory perception, there is no accepted scientific evidence that precognition is a real phenomenon and it is widely considered to be pseudoscience.
  12. Psionics Psionics is the study of paranormal phenomena in relation to the application of electronics. The term comes from psi and the -onics from electronics. It is closely related to the field of radionics. There is no scientific evidence that psionic abilities exist.
  13. Psychic Powers Psychic Powers are believed by some to be had by psychics who are people who profess an ability to perceive information hidden from the normal senses through extrasensory perception (ESP) or are said by others to have such abilities.
  14. Psychometry Psychometry, also known as token-object reading is a form of extrasensory perception characterized by the claimed ability to make relevant associations from an object of unknown history by making physical contact with that object
  15. Pyrokinesis Pyrokinesis is the purported psychic ability allowing a person to create and control fire with the mind. There is no conclusive evidence that pyrokinesis is a real phenomenon.
  16. Remote Viewing Remote viewing is the practice of seeking impressions about a distant or unseen target, purportedly using extrasensory perception or “sensing” with the mind. Remote viewing experiments have historically been criticized for lack of proper controls and repeat ability.
  17. Spiritualism Spiritualism is a movement based on the belief that the spirits of the dead exist and have both the ability and the inclination to communicate with the living. The afterlife, or the “spirit world”, is seen by spiritualists, not as a static place, but as one in which spirits continue to evolve.
  18. Telekinisis Telekinesis or Psychokinesis, is an alleged psychic ability allowing a person to move objects without touching them as well as influence a physical system without physical interaction. Psychokinesis experiments have historically been criticized for lack of proper controls and repeatability.
  19. Telepathy Telepathy is the purported vicarious transmission of information from one person to another without using any known human sensory channels or physical interaction.
  20. X-Ray Vision X-Ray Vision has little to do with the actual effect of X-rays. Instead, it is usually presented as the ability to selectively see through certain objects as though they are invisible or translucent in order to see objects or surfaces.
